Meta (META) to cut 10% of jobs in efficiency push, equivalent to 8,000 jobs, according to Bloomberg

Meta's decision to cut 10% of its workforce, translating to around 8,000 jobs, signals a significant efficiency push as the company seeks to streamline operations.
